Guys I have run into something that i have never seen on any of the tail draggersI have flown.


The gentleman that started the project I am working on has the front rudder pedals connected across the firewall area with a pulley system that I guess is ment to make the pedals work together. I have always had a spring on each pedal to return it to center, like the drawing calls for. Since I am working on the controls at this point just wondering if any of you have seen this type of set up and if so what are the advantages, disadvantages of the system. I am incline to remove the system and go with the return spring on each pedal but hate to rework another component he installed if it has a benefit.
